Cheaper
Physical media has a set price tag attached to it and stays pretty fixed, as it is a physical product that needs to be made and packaged and stored on shelves, and it is, or was, a stable market that did not have any competition, so there were rarely any price fluctuations. Compare that to now, where there are so many digital games and publishers, which cost almost nothing to set up and sell, so there are numerous sites and stores where you can buy games for next to nothing or see different prices, like this platform for competitive game pricing where you can get a quick handy overview of prices and make a decision. You will also see much better sales more often online, with discounts often going to 50% off or more.
Convenient and Accessible
Absolutely one of the main benefits of online marketplaces for gaming is just how incredibly convenient it is. You do not need to drive to a store, see if they even have the game in stock, wait in line at the counter, pay, drive back home, and so on. No, all you need to do is boot up your pc, laptop, or console, open your gaming platform, and you can browse through thousands of titles, read reviews, compare prices, and purchase and add them to your library in just a few clicks.
Multiplayer Necessity
For many, many people, online gaming, playing, and connecting with other players from all over the globe is one of the most important aspects of gaming; for some, it is even the reason why they are gaming in the first place. Making friends, building connections, communicating, and teamwork are all hugely integral parts of many games, and the internet and online platforms for games have made it unbelievably easy to connect with other players, chat or voice chat, and join other players in-game with just a few clicks, concepts that just weren’t in place before.
Digital Advantages
Now there are pros and cons to both physical and digital games, but physical media can be lost, for example, broken, scratched, or the like. Digital games are all stored in one place, and while this can have issues like losing your account or getting hacked, there are solutions and preventative measures for such scenarios, and the ease of access and comfort of a storefront like Steam simply cannot be denied, as hundreds of millions of people will tell you.
